Postcode KT8 2HE is located in a major urban area, within the Molesey West ward of Elmbridge in the South East region, and forms part of the West Molesey South area. It has low deprivation and average crime levels, with around 55.1 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 34% below the South East average of 84 per 1,000. The average income per household in West Molesey South is £61,946 per year. The nearest station is Hersham, about 1.3 miles away. There are 3 primary and no secondary schools in the area.

Approximately 9.4%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 20.3% of dwellings are socially rented.

No significant noise sources from railways or roads near KT8 2HE.
West Molesey South near KT8 2HE has medium flood risk (between 1% and 3.3% chance of a flood each year) from rivers and sea.
